Worked Example
Let's calculate the nutrition for a Chicken Bowl with:
- Grilled Chicken (200 calories, 28g protein, 6g fat, 0g carbs)
- Brown Rice (110 calories, 2g protein, 1g fat, 22g carbs)
- Black Beans (110 calories, 8g protein, 1g fat, 20g carbs)
- Guacamole (160 calories, 2g protein, 15g fat, 10g carbs)
The total nutrition would be:
- Calories: 200 + 110 + 110 + 160 = 580 calories
- Protein: 28 + 2 + 8 + 2 = 40g
- Fat: 6 + 1 + 1 + 15 = 23g
- Carbs: 0 + 22 + 20 + 10 = 52g
